We will let our illustrations provide most of the description of this offering except to advise the viewer that what you are looking at is an all original Confederate officers forage cap as seen in the example published on page 164 of Time / Life's ECHOES of GLORY - Arms & Equipment of the Confederacy. (see also, an example published from the Museum of the Confederacy collection in Gallery Books Commanders of the Civil War. The hat measures a full 5 inches high from it's bound, tarred linen bill to top edge of it's quatrifoiled crown. The side buttons are the usual staff type back marked EXTRA QUALITY. This rare example of Confederate headgear remains in excellent condition with minimal mothing and demonstrates good evidence of period use and originality. The brown polished cotton liner is intact but with an inconsequential split now and again as good evidence of age and originality. There is a small 2 1/2 inch section of the pig skin sweat band that has parted ways with the bulk of the feature solidly in place with solid evidence of originality.
